This special seminar explores how Weyl-invariant Einstein-Cartan gravity, when combined with the Standard Model of particle physics, reveals a unified approach to solving both the strong CP and hierarchy puzzles. Learn how this theoretical framework introduces just one extra scalar degree of freedom with axion-like properties that addresses the strong CP-problem. Discover how the small mass of this particle and the cosmological constant are related to tiny values of gauge coupling constants of the local Lorentz group. Examine the implications for the Higgs boson mass and Majorana leptons, which appear to be very small or vanishing at tree level, suggesting potential computability through nonperturbative effects. The presentation by Misha Shaposhnikov from EPFL offers insights into this elegant theoretical approach that connects fundamental problems in particle physics and cosmology.
